Transaction d4ba53126de6143e32fd1f0524af37f33a41be4a5fa93e5e4d382d20fb7f5e35

1 Input
2 Outputs
  • d4ba53126de6143e32fd1f0524af37f33a41be4a5fa93e5e4d382d20fb7f5e35:0
  • value  20089191
    address  1LKDBeieP61xRMTT5XNrCjaF5LEr9fPypA
  • d4ba53126de6143e32fd1f0524af37f33a41be4a5fa93e5e4d382d20fb7f5e35:1
  • value  11975311
    address  32kskHxQTMe91GbSmeCNg1ExoYxQDN4LTA